Job description

SUMMARY
The Terminal Manager will supervise the Terminal leadership members, as well as their subordinates,
while overseeing daily operations of the barge unloading and customer truck loading and shipping
process that is aligned with the organization's overall strategy. Will identify workplace hazards through
workplace inspections, assess risks and conduct job safety analysis. Ensure team members are
appropriately trained. Deliver task specific training as required. Observe, mentor, coach and develop
team members ensuring job capabilities, competencies and program/policy application and use.
R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and deal with changes, delays, or unexpected events at a 24/7/365 operation.
  • Demonstrate ability to communicate effectively, both verbally and in writing.
  • Ensure quick, efficient, and accurate measures are being followed to service all customers.
  • Continually seek areas of improvement to better service customers.
  • Improve Terminal availability and uptime through proactive measures and planned maintenance.
  • Ensure that Terminal employees adhere to and are always following safety rules.
  • Ensure proper communication is occurring between Terminal and Maintenance.
  • Coordinate team members to ensure all areas are operated safely and efficiently.
  • Lead weekly crew meetings covering safety, efficiencies, and manpower.
  • Foster an environment where continuous process improvement initiatives are promoted.
  • Implement process and safety standards and procedures.
  • Assist with coordinating and managing crew schedules.
  • Ensure team members are skilled in the expected tasks to be performed.
  • Perform general maintenance and troubleshooting as needed.
  • Assist with training and development of team members.
  • Analyze and resolve work problems or assist operators in solving work problems.
  • Approve all overtime prior to commencing.
  • Complete special projects as assigned.
  • Always serve as an excellent Company ambassador and safety champion.

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E
  • High school diploma and/or GED
  • Bilingual preferred.
  • 2+ years of manufacturing, mining, or aggregate environment preferred.
  • 5+ years of supervisory and leadership experience preferred.
  • Experience within Shipping/Receiving/Logistics/DOT, and Customer Relations is highly preferred.
  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Office, Word, and Excel
